    摘要:

    通过对也门1区块白云岩分布、岩性特点、颜色以及白云岩矿物电镜扫描特征的分析,研究白云岩化过程对油气成藏的影响。也门1区块白云岩具有厚度大、分布范围狭窄的特点,主要分布在Imad-1井附近。白云石晶体多呈白糖状,具有鞍状白云岩的主要特征,虽见介壳化石,但仅保留了原来的痕迹,且在岩心和薄片中未见生物成因白云岩的球状、不规则针刺状或菱形晶体特征。也门1区块白云岩颜色较深,呈灰—深灰色,表明其富含铁、锰元素。上述特征均指向也门1区块白云岩为热液成因,推测热液主要源自深部富含镁离子的液体,沿不整合面或者断层渗入到相关地层中,与地层中富含钙离子的灰岩、石膏等进行交换,最终形成了分布局限、厚度较大的白云岩。白云岩在形成了有利储集空间的同时,也对盖层和保存条件造成了破坏,加上断层的影响,研究区东南部区域形成规模油气藏的潜力不大,建议未来也门1区块的勘探应集中在西北部的玛格拉夫劳达构造带。

    Abstract:

    With the analysis of the distribution,lithology,color and mineral features under SEM of the dolomite,the origin of the dolomite in Block1 in Yemen and the impact of dolomitization on oil and gas accumulation were studied. The thickness of dolomite in Block1 is large but it distributes in a very limited area near Well Imad-1. The crystals of dolomite look like sugar with main features of saddle dolomite. Only the traces of shell fossils are observed. There is no sphere,irregular thorns and rhombic shapes observed in dolomite cores and thin sections. And the dolomite is grey-dark grey,the dark color of which indicates that the dolomite contains high contents of ferrum and manganese. All these feature points to hydrothermal genesis of the dolomite of Block1 in Yemen. It is inferred that hydrothermal fluid comes mainly from the deep area with abundant Mg2+ ions. It flowed upward to the upper strata through the faults or disconformity and exchange between Ca2+ from the limestone and anhydrite and Mg2+ from the hydrothermal fluid occurred. Finally,some thick dolomite rocks developed near the faults(or disconformity)with limited lateral distribution. The formation of dolomite can increase the pore spaces of the reservoir,but it can damage the cap rock and preservation condition. Considering the influence of faults as well,it is believed the southeast area in Block1 has lower potential of oil and gas accumulation,but the Magraf belt in northwest area is suggested as future exploration target in Block1.
